June 28,1970
On the one year anniversary of the Stonewall riots, more than 2,000 people marched in New York City. This was the first gay pride parade in the United States.
Stonewall Riots
Members of the gay LGBT community had series of multiple, violent events. They led up to the important even for the gay liberation movement and the fight for LGBT rights in the United States. Gay Americans in the 1950's and 1960's faced an anti-gay legal system. Very few places welcomed openly gay people. Most places were bars, even if the bar managers or managers weren't gay. At the time the Stonewall Inn was owned by the mafia. Drag queens, transgenders, male prostitutes and homeless kids would hang out in there. Police raids on gay bars were routine in the 60's, but the officers lost control of the situation most of the time.
